Key learnings from this report

  • The Software Java Engineers job market in Bulgaria reflects notable fluctuations, with a net difference between new job openings and closures indicating a complex and competitive recruitment environment.
  • There are currently around 5 job openings for every Software Java Engineer, suggesting a challenging landscape for hiring managers aiming to fill these roles in Bulgaria.
  • Sofia emerges as the dominant city for Software Java Developer opportunities, accounting for 86% of the total job openings in the country, thus necessitating tailored recruitment strategies for the capital.
  • The majority of positions (63%) in the market are for Mid-Senior level candidates, underscoring the strong demand for experienced Software Java Engineers and guiding hiring strategies toward targeting this talent pool.
  • The median time to hire for Software Engineers in Bulgaria stands at 33 days, indicating the urgency in recruitment and the need for hiring managers to engage candidates promptly to streamline their hiring processes.
Number of roles opened and closed for Java Engineers in Bulgaria in the last 3 months

Number of roles opened and closed for Java Engineers in Bulgaria in the last 3 months

In the past 12 weeks, the Software Java Engineers job market in Bulgaria has demonstrated notable fluctuations, with a peak of 67 new positions opened in week 27, contrasting sharply with a low of just 7 in week 29. Despite these openings, closures of Software Java Developer roles have also been significant, peaking at 52 closed jobs in week 31. The net difference between openings and closures indicates a complex market environment, where recruitment strategies for CTOs in Bulgaria's tech sector must adapt swiftly. Compared to other roles within the country and similar positions in other European countries, the demand for Software Java Developers remains robust, yet competitive.

Talent pool vs job openings for Software Engineers in Bulgaria

How competitive it is to hire Software Engineers in Bulgaria

In analyzing the current landscape for Software Java Engineers across Europe, the data reveals a ratio of job openings to the available talent pool that varies significantly by country. In Bulgaria, there are approximately 5 job openings for every available Software Java Engineer, indicating a competitive environment for hiring. In contrast, countries like Poland and Romania are experiencing similar trends, with approximately 4 and 6 job openings per talent, respectively, while the Czech Republic stands out with a ratio of 8 job openings per Software Java Engineer. This disparity suggests that hiring managers in Bulgaria may face greater challenges in filling Software Java roles compared to their counterparts in these other European nations, underscoring the need for strategic recruitment approaches in this market.

Seniority distribution of Java Engineer job openings in Bulgaria

Seniority Distribution of Java Engineering Jobs in Bulgaria

The seniority distribution of Software Java Engineering jobs in Bulgaria reveals a strong presence of Mid-Senior level positions, accounting for 63% of the market. Entry level roles comprise 25%, while Associate positions represent 5% of the job landscape. This trend underscores the demand for experienced Software Java Engineers, indicating potential hiring strategies that focus on attracting mid to senior-level talent.

Pre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Bulgaria

In Bulgaria's software development landscape, the employment type distribution reveals a strong preference for Full-time roles, comprising 96% of the available positions. This is followed by Contract roles at 2% and Part-time opportunities at 1%. Such data indicates a robust full-time job market, offering insight for hiring managers aiming to attract talent in the competitive Software Java Engineers job market trends in Bulgaria.

Time to Hire Distribution for Software in Bulgaria

How long does it take to hire Software Engineers

The time to hire distribution for Software Java Engineers in Bulgaria reveals significant trends that hiring managers should consider. With a notable 779 roles taking approximately 30 days to fill, this suggests a competitive market where swift decisions are crucial. The landscape indicates that 55% of positions are secured within 30 to 50 days, reflecting both a demand for efficiency and the necessity for robust recruitment strategies. In contrast, only 11 positions were filled in 100 days or longer, highlighting the importance of timely engagement to attract top talent. As you navigate the software Java job market in Bulgaria, these insights provide a clear framework for evaluating recruitment timelines.

Most popular cities in Bulgaria to hire Software Engineers

Top 5 cities in Bulgaria to hire Software Engineers

The software Java Engineers job market in Bulgaria exhibits significant concentration in Sofia, which holds 86% of the total job openings reported. Following Sofia, Plovdiv accounts for 6% of the openings, while Varna contributes 3%. This data underscores Sofia's dominance as the primary hub for Software Java Developer opportunities in Bulgaria, setting the stage for recruitment strategies tailored to the capital's competitive landscape.

Most sought after technologies in Bulgaria for Java

Key technologies for Java Engineers

In the Software Java Engineers job market in Bulgaria, several key technologies dominate the landscape. Java, with a usage frequency of 9117, stands out as the primary programming language, closely followed by Spring and Spring Boot, which are essential frameworks for building enterprise applications, with frequencies of 2042 and 2281 respectively. Other important technologies include Microservices (2380), which support scalable application architecture, and SQL (1921), a fundamental database management language crucial for data manipulation. The attached chart provides a visual representation of these technologies’ prevalence, offering insights for hiring managers aiming to identify the skills most sought after in candidates.
